Transcription
[Translation:]

Saturday, June 19, 1915. After a walk
visited the gallery [above: II] – modern [above: I].
(three magnificent Klimts. [1]) 2h30 • S.
In the afternoon took the funicular to the
observation tower returning via Kleinseite.
Evening at home.
Annotations
[1] Gustav Klimt (1862–1918).
